Add queueRequest() function to the Algorithm class. The queueRequest() function
provides controls values coming from the application to each algorithm.
Each algorithm is responsible for retrieving the controls associated to them.

+/**
+ * \fn Algorithm::queueRequest()
+ * \brief Provide control values to the algorithm
+ * \param[in] context The shared IPA context
+ * \param[in] frame The frame number to apply the control values
+ * \param[in] controls The list of user controls
+ *
+ * This function is called for each request queued to the camera. It provides
+ * the controls stored in the request to the algorithm. The \a frame number
+ * is the Request sequence number and identifies the desired corresponding
+ * frame to target for the controls to take effect.
+ *
+ * Algorithms shall read the applicable controls and store their value for later
+ * use during frame processing.
+ */
